Jurinea

  • COMMON NAME:Jurinea

  • ARABIC:جوريينيا

  • BOTANICAL NAME:Jurinea carduiformis (Jaub. & Spach) Boiss.

  • SYNONYMS:Outreya carduiformis Jaub. & Spach

  • FAMILY:ASTERACEAE

  • KIND:Native

  • EMIRATE:Fujairah

  • GROWTH FORMS:Herbs

  • HABITATS:Slope (Rocky)

  • TYPES:Annual


DESCRIPTION:

Annual, forming small cushions on the ground. Stems very short. Leaves radiating from base, linear 0.5* 10-15 cm, crinkly edge, rounded tip. Flowerheads up to 15 in center of plant, c. 5 cm across, thistle-like, white, with spiny involucral bracts. Flowering from February to April.
